Share Cite Follow WebbThere are two pivot points here, namely the two ends of the log on either side of the gorge. You can assume that the 4,120.2N weight (from the 420kg mass, with g=9.81m/s^2) applies to the middle of the log. So - in the absence of Indiana Jones - the downward force at either end will be 2060.1N.
